[Checkins] SVN: z3c.pt/trunk/src/z3c/pt/ Convert unicode static attributes to UTF-8.
Malthe Borch
mborch at gmail.com
Mon Aug 11 15:22:49 EDT 2008
Log message for revision 89680:
Convert unicode static attributes to UTF-8.
Changed:
U z3c.pt/trunk/src/z3c/pt/clauses.py
U z3c.pt/trunk/src/z3c/pt/translation.txt
-=-
Modified: z3c.pt/trunk/src/z3c/pt/clauses.py
===================================================================
--- z3c.pt/trunk/src/z3c/pt/clauses.py 2008-08-11 18:33:50 UTC (rev 89679)
+++ z3c.pt/trunk/src/z3c/pt/clauses.py 2008-08-11 19:22:49 UTC (rev 89680)
@@ -497,6 +497,8 @@
stream.outdent()
else:
for attribute, expression in static:
+ if isinstance(expression, unicode):
+ expression = expression.encode('utf-8')
stream.out(
' %s="%s"' % (attribute, escape(expression, '"')))
Modified: z3c.pt/trunk/src/z3c/pt/translation.txt
===================================================================
--- z3c.pt/trunk/src/z3c/pt/translation.txt 2008-08-11 18:33:50 UTC (rev 89679)
+++ z3c.pt/trunk/src/z3c/pt/translation.txt 2008-08-11 19:22:49 UTC (rev 89680)
@@ -36,9 +36,11 @@
>>> print render("""\
... <div xmlns="http://www.w3.org/1999/xhtml">
+ ... La Peña
... <img alt="La Peña" />
... </div>""", translate_xml)
<div>
+ La Peña
<img alt="La Peña" />
</div>
More information about the Checkins
mailing list